Role Overview

We're seeking an experienced and creative Games Design Lecturer to join our Creative Industries team. You'll deliver engaging and effective teaching across Levels 2 and 3, helping students explore theory and develop practical skills in game art, design, and development.





Key Responsibilities

  • Plan, design, and deliver high-quality lessons in games design and development.
  • Support and inspire students through practical workshops, project-based learning, and portfolio development.
  • Guide students in software use (e.g., Unity, Unreal, Maya, 3ds Max), 2D/3D asset creation, narrative design, mechanics, and user experience.
  • Continuously design and assess student work, providing timely feedback.
  • Collaborate with industry professionals and coordinate project showcases or industry-linked brief days.
  • Participate in curriculum development and mapping to BTEC/VRQ frameworks.
  • Promote safeguarding and equality, ensuring supportive learning environments.
  • Engage in college initiatives, outreach, enrichment, and student progression planning.



Person Specification



Essential:

  • Relevant degree or vocational qualification in Games Design, Game Art, Multimedia, Computer Science with Game modules, or related fields.
  • Industry experience in games design, asset creation, or interactive media.
  • Familiarity with relevant software (e.g., Unity, Unreal Engine, graphic and modeling tools).
  • Excellent communication, organisational, and teamwork skills.
  • Valid enhanced DBS clearance.

Desirable:

  • Experience teaching in FE/higher education or mentoring aspiring game developers.
  • Knowledge of student assessment and feedback processes.
  • A portfolio of published or student-based game projects and an understanding of current industry trends.
